Your Impact
Consulting and accompanying organizations in the BORS environment (police, fire department, rescue services, civil protection, management staff, authorities) on strategic, organizational and operational issues.
Leadership and control of projects and transformation projects in the BORS environment, especially in cross-organizational constellations with high demands on coordination, reliability and impact.
Analysis and further development of cooperation and deployment structures (e.g. management organizations, training and deployment organizations, interfaces between BORS partners) to improve performance in everyday life and in special and extraordinary situations.
Concept and implementation of digitization and innovation projects in the BORS context, for example in the areas of deployment support, situation picture, communication or process automation.
Active design and further development of our service portfolio in the area of security / BORS, in particular through the deepening and further development of relevant topics such as resilience, crisis management, staff training and cross-organizational cooperation.
